Output 13f3270bf8ecc852ad1a5bf65998cf96254d96d9fc6ba5a42d6e1d1fe71f79ba:23

value
20675267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a43c1d75e7f683b2defafd61ba64255f656fcb9e OP_EQUAL
address
MNsZ4kzpqg8wzfFWo5AhsEpSKSQPsKZnvR
transaction
13f3270bf8ecc852ad1a5bf65998cf96254d96d9fc6ba5a42d6e1d1fe71f79ba
spent
true